How much in advance do I have to reserve my dumpster?

As with any service, it's almost always an excellent strategy to allow your dumpster as far ahead as you possibly can in order to make sure the dumpster will be available when you really need it. If you wait until the last minute, there's no guarantee the company will likely manage to fill your order.

Two or three days notice is generally sufficient to ensure your dumpster delivery on time. Keep in mind the most active days have a tendency to be on Mondays and Fridays (surrounding the weekend), so if you're able to organize your mission for the middle of the week, you've got a increased opportunity of getting the dumpster you'll need.

Should you find out you want a dumpster the next day or even the same day, please go right ahead and phone the business. If they have what you need, they'll certainly make arrangements to get it to you as soon as possible.

Some Things You Can't Put into Your Dumpster

Although the particular rules that control what you can and cannot comprise in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several types of stuff that most dumpster rental service in Washingtons will not permit. Some of the things that you usually cannot set in the dumpster comprise:

Batteries, especially the type that include m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they include oils and other chemicals that can damage the environment) Electronics, especially the ones that include batteries There are likewise some mattresses which you can generally set in your dumpster provided that you're willing to pay an additional f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ires

When in doubt, it is better to contact your rental company to get a record of stuff that you just can't put into the dumpster.


Deciding Where to Put Your Dumpster

Deciding where to put your dumpster can get a large effect on how fast you finish jobs. The most efficient option would be to choose a location that is near the worksite. It's important, nevertheless, to consider whether this location is a safe alternative. Make sure that the area is free of obstructions that could trip individuals while they carry heavy debris.

Lots of individuals decide to place dumpsters in their own driveways. This is really a convenient alternative since it generally means you can avoid requesting the city for a license or permit. In case you need to place the dumpster on the road, then you definitely should get in touch with your local government to ask whether you are required to get a permit. Although a lot of municipalities will let folks keep dumpsters on the road for short levels of time, others will ask you to fill out some paperwork. Following these rules can help you stay away from fines that will make your project more expensive.

What Size Dumpster Do I Want for a Roofing Job?

Choosing a dumpster size necessitates some educated guesswork. It is often problematic for people to gauge the sizes that they need for roofing jobs because, realistically, they have no idea how much material their roofs feature.

There are, however,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make a good option. If you are removing a commercial roof, then you'll likely need a dumpster that provides you at least 40 square yards.

If you are working on residential roofing project, then you can ordinarily rely on a smaller size. You can typically exp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will likely need a 20-yard dumpster.

A lot of people order one size bigger than they think their endeavors will require since they want to stay away from the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ters that were not large enough.


Dumpster Rental in Washington Costs: Flat Rate vs Per Ton

In case you are looking to rent a dumpster in Washington, one of your main considerations is going to be price. There are generally two pricing options available when renting a dumpster in Washington. Flat rate is pricing determined by the size of the dumpster, not the quantity of material you place in it. Per ton pricing will charge you based on the weight you need hauled.

One type of pricing structure is not necessarily more expensive than the other. In the event you know exactly how much material you need to throw away, you might get a better deal with per ton pricing. On the other hand, flat rate pricing can assist you to keep a limit on costs when you are dealing with unknown weights.
